Crushed Stone, Hard, 3/8" Size
Crushed stone in a hard, 3/8" size range is a durable aggregate produced by mechanically breaking down larger rocks into angular fragments. The "hard" attribute indicates a high level of compressive strength and resistance to wear, making this material especially suitable for demanding construction environments.
The 3/8" size offers a balance between compaction and drainage, making it ideal for use as a base layer beneath pavers, in concrete mixes, or as a top dressing for driveways and walkways. Its small, angular particles interlock well, providing stability while still allowing for adequate water runoff. Common applications include residential patios, pathways, and commercial landscaping projects. The main advantage of this size and hardness is its longevity and resistance to shifting under load, though it may be less suitable for areas requiring a softer or more decorative finish.
